Milestones

1998: Founded as the National Endowment for Science, Technology and the Arts with a £250M lottery endowment

Became an independent charity in 2012

Created the Mapping AI Governance project tracking global AI policy initiatives

Published influential research on innovation, AI governance, and education

Launched numerous programs supporting social innovation

Created data visualizations mapping the global AI governance landscape
